Sea fishing at Rhyl, the first session of the holiday, and chatting with Jeff Pearson

There was no fishing on vacation arrival day, as once I’d got settled in it was off to a working football game.

The following day, however, it was on track as the sea angling gear put in an appearance for the first time this year.

After being out and about in the area during the day itself, I set off for a late session at Rhyl harbour, although as with all the sessions this week, technically on the Kinmel Bay side of the river.

I was joined by Jeff Pearson, who presents the afternoon show on Bayside Radio, which is based just along the coast at Colwyn Bay.

A considerable chunk of the video is taken up with chat, where we talk memories, angling and even the 20 mph speed limit in Wales.

As for the fishing, that’s in the video, and I caught three rockling (three-bearded) on lugworm.

I do like them as a species.

I fished ninety minutes up to high water and likewise beyond.

Tackle: 12ft Okuma Salina rods, Jarvis Walker Mirage 7000 reels. 20lb line, two-hook rigs and 4 ounce leads. Size 2/4 Aberdeen hooks.
